Crown Institute of Business and Technology Pty Ltd (trading as Crown Institute of Business and Technology) is a private CRICOS-registered provider established to offer quality education to both domestic and international students. With a registered capacity of 1,636 international students, the institute delivers 22 active courses across Certificate III, Certificate IV, Diploma, Advanced Diploma, and Graduate Diploma levels. The institute’s fields of education include Management and Commerce (e.g., Diploma of Business, Advanced Diploma of Leadership and Management), Information Technology (e.g., Diploma of Information Technology), Education (e.g., Graduate Diploma in Education), Society and Culture (e.g., Diploma of Community Services), and Food, Hospitality and Personal Services (e.g., Certificate III in Hospitality). As a private provider, Crown Institute of Business and Technology operates independently of government funding, focusing on industry-relevant training and flexible study modes. All courses carry ESOS Act protections, meaning international students have access to tuition fee refunds and support services if the provider fails to deliver. In the CRICOS system, providers are categorised as Government (public universities, TAFEs, and government schools) or Private (independent colleges, language schools, and other non-government institutions). Crown Institute of Business and Technology is a private provider. Private colleges often offer more specialised vocational courses, smaller class sizes, and flexible intake dates compared to large public institutions. They are independently owned and operated, but must adhere to the same CRICOS registration standards and ESOS Act obligations as government providers. This means international students receive the same legal protections, including the requirement for providers to deliver courses as marketed, maintain accurate CRICOS registration, and provide refunds for course cancellations. When choosing a private college, it's important to verify its CRICOS status and check course fees, as they are set by the institution and subject to change. Applying to Crown Institute of Business and Technology is a straightforward process. Follow these three steps:
1. **Research CRICOS-registered providers** – Use HeadStart Academy to filter courses by level, field, and city. From our institution profile, review the 22 courses offered by Crown Institute of Business and Technology. Check entry requirements, fees, and location preferences.
2. **Apply directly to your chosen institution** – Visit the institute’s website at https://www.cibt.edu.au or contact their admissions team. Submit your application with required documents (academic transcripts, English test results, passport copy). Note application deadlines and any additional conditions such as interviews or portfolio submissions.
3. **Receive your Confirmation of Enrolment (CoE) and apply for your Student visa** – Once accepted, the institution will issue a CoE, which is required for the Student visa (Subclass 500) application. Complete the visa application online via the Department of Home Affairs, attach your CoE, and pay the visa fee. Await visa grant and make travel arrangements.
HeadStart Academy recommends applying at least 3–4 months before your intended start date to allow for visa processing times.

Crown Institute of Business and Technology Pty Ltd (CRICOS 02870D) is a Private provider in North Sydney, NSW with 22 currently non-expired CRICOS courses [CRICOS register, Apr 2026].
Example course from the register: Diploma of Accounting (CRICOS 097748J) is listed at 65 weeks with tuition A$15,000 and estimated total A$15,500 [CRICOS register, Apr 2026].
